St Andrew’s School Turi is one of the most prominent international schools in Kenya and has an outstanding reputation throughout Africa.  Founded as a Preparatory School for the children of expatriates in 1931, it has grown to comprise both Preparatory and Senior Schools to welcome children over 25 nationalities, the majority of whom are now African.  The Senior School is a full boarding school.

The Senior School was founded in 1988 and is a member of COBIS and global member of Round Square.  It aims to provide a world class education with outstanding teaching and learning central to its vision of creating leaders that will change their country, continental and the world for good.  Students are prepared for GCSE/IGCSE and A level exams and move on to universities in the UK, America, Australia and many other parts of the world.

The School is situated on a beautiful 400 acre site on the western slopes of Rift Valley some 200km NW of Nairobi, near the Equator and at 2600m where the climate is temperature.  It is a malaria free zone.  All teaching staff are housed in the School compound together with their families.  The School has a modern Sports Centre which has a gym and other sporting activities which is open to all teaching staff and their families.  Families can also enjoy bird watching, kayaking, walking, jogging and other activities in the School compound which is secured with an electric fence.
